Установка и настройка SNMP на CentOS 7
Краткое руководство по подключению и настройке протокола SNMP для мониторинга на базе CentOS 7
Ставим snmpd
yum install net-snmp-utils net-snmp
настраиваем конфигурационный файл
mv /etc/snmp/snmp.conf /etc/snmp/snmp.conf2
nano /etc/snmp/snmp.conf
в самый конец файл добавляем
rocommunity public (не меням)
syslocation «myserver» (не меняем)
syscontact my@email.net (можете указать актуальный e-mail)
перезагружаем службу
service snmpd restart
проверяем работоспособность
snmpwalk -v 1 -c public -O e 127.0.0.1
В результате видим что-то подобное
SNMPv2-MIB::sysORUpTime.1 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.2 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.3 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.4 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.5 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.6 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.7 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.8 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.9 = Timeticks: (6) 0:00:00.06
SNMPv2-MIB::sysORUpTime.10 = Timeticks: (6) 0:00:00.06
HOST-RESOURCES-MIB::hrSystemUptime.0 = Timeticks: (7030834) 19:31:48.34